BUYING INTO GERMAN DEBT

Private equity firms are making inroads into Germany's corporate debt markets

Capital-starved German Mittelstand businesses do not have much to cheer about at present. But the launch in October of Deutsche Kredit Börse, a new debt exchange in Munich, looks like a welcome exception.

The new bourse, which will allow institutions to trade corporate loans made to small-to medium-sized German companies, is backed by Lehman Brothers.
